Ohio Revised Code § 2329.49 - Remedy When One Of Cosureties Pays For Such Property.

When a defendant in a judgment, or his surety or cosurety, by mistake has directed an execution issued on the judgment to be levied on property not liable thereto, thereby causing such judgment to be wholly or in part satisfied, and has been compelled to pay the owner of the property therefor, he has the same rights against a codefendant in such judgment, and against a cosurety or principal in respect of the debts on which such judgment is founded, as though such satisfaction, by due process of law, had been made out of the property of such defendant, surety, or cosurety so directing such levy.

Effective Date: 10-01-1953
